Trainer certification for the certificate course “Economic competence for more effectiveness and efficiency in Chinese factories and companies”

Education and especially vocational education are considered worldwide as the engine for economic development, product and process innovations, competitiveness and social stability. However, many countries do not have the ability to meet the existing and increasing need for qualifying their skilled personnel through their own education systems. The educational demand and with it the potential for international markets for (further) education are enormous. Internationally, there is a high interest to benefit from the German competences and strengths in the area of vocational education.

The Chair of Business and Economic Education is taking part in a joint research project funded by the Federal Ministry of Education and Research, whose task is the implementation of a further education offer for the advancement of  “Economic competence for more effectiveness in China”. The project is offering a cross-cultural concept for constituting economic competence of (prospective) skilled personnel and executives. It aims at the optimization of the value chain processes regarding effectiveness and efficiency by making the persons involved in these processes understand economic interrelations in such way as to enable them to act with economic competence in their job.

The Chair of Business and Economic Education is responsible for the development, scientific supervision and evaluation of the workshop-concept regarding the multiplier/trainer/examiner certification in China. Furthermore, it carries out the analysis and the implementation-oriented preparation of factors of success as well as the identification of specific barriers and constraints for the export of the multiplier/trainer/examiner certifications. Additionally, the chair is developing transferable methods and instruments for the systematic development of services regarding the process of the internationalization of services of education relating to the multiplier/trainer/examiner certification of the education offer.

Project management: Prof. Dr. Thomas Retzmann (University of Duisburg-Essen)

Project staff: Dipl.-Kfm. Karsten Schroeder (University of Duisburg-Essen)

Project partners: EB Cert GmbH, University of Applied Sciences Cologne, RKWC GmbH

Project funding: Federal Ministry of Education and ResearchProject aim: Development, scientific supervision and evaluation of the workshop-concept regarding the multiplier/trainer/examiner certification in China

Project period: October 2012 until September 2015
